When you work with Legendary Fence Company Belleville, you choose from a full range of commercial grade chain link materials and configurations.
We install both galvanized and black or color coated chain link. Galvanized systems are the most economical and are ideal for industrial yards and utility sites. Color coated chain link, most often black, uses a vinyl or polymer coating over galvanized steel, which provides additional corrosion protection and a more polished appearance suitable for offices, schools, and retail sites.
Mesh sizes typically range from 2 inches for standard commercial security to tighter meshes for special applications, such as storage areas that must prevent hand access. Wire gauges are selected based on security needs, with heavier gauges used for high traffic or high impact areas. Heights most commonly start at 6 feet for basic commercial security, with 8, 10, and 12 foot options, plus barbed wire or razor ribbon if required.
For added privacy or wind reduction, we can integrate privacy slats or wind screens. These are often used around car lots, storage yards, and waste or recycling areas in Belleville where screening is important. We also provide custom gates, from simple walk gates to wide cantilever or double swing vehicle gates that accommodate semi truck access and fire code requirements.

Our commercial chain link fence installations follow a structured process designed around commercial timeframes and safety standards.
First, we mark post locations and call in utility locates to avoid underground lines. Next, our crews drill or auger post holes to the appropriate depth, typically 30 to 42 inches depending on fence height, wind load, and soil conditions common in the Belleville area. We set terminal, corner, and gate posts in concrete, taking care to align them accurately. Line posts are then installed and spaced to support the specific mesh and height selected.
Once concrete has set to the required strength, we attach top rails and, if specified, bottom rails or tension wire. For high traffic or high security sites, we often recommend a bottom rail to prevent animals or intruders from lifting the fabric. The chain link fabric is then stretched tightly between terminal posts using professional tensioning equipment, tied to the line posts and rails, and secured with tension bands and ties.
Gates are hung last and adjusted so they swing freely, close securely, and align with any access control hardware. Throughout the process, we maintain jobsite cleanliness and coordinate around your operations, scheduling work to minimize disruption to parking, loading docks, and customer access.
Commercial properties in Belleville experience freeze-thaw cycles, summer heat, and the occasional strong storm. Legendary Fence Company Belleville designs your chain link fence to handle these conditions without constant repair.
Concrete footings are sized for local frost depth and soil type so posts do not heave or lean over time. For areas exposed to frequent vehicle contact, such as around parking lots or truck routes, we can install heavier schedule 40 or even schedule 80 posts, protective bollards, or offset the fence line to reduce impact risk.
For security, we consider not only fence height but also climb resistance and visibility. Chain link allows clear sight lines for cameras and security personnel, which is critical for many industrial and municipal clients. Where higher security is required, we can add outward-facing barbed wire arms, razor ribbon, or anti-climb mesh. For schools and public facilities, we balance security with safety and appearance, often using taller black coated chain link with secure gate hardware without aggressive toppings.
We also pay attention to drainage. In low areas around Belleville, standing water can corrode posts and hardware faster if they are not properly set. We adjust footing depth, concrete mix, and grading at the fence line to help water move away from the structure.
The cost of a commercial chain link fence varies, and Legendary Fence Company Belleville is upfront about what drives the price so you can plan accurately.
Key cost factors include fence height, total linear footage, material type (standard galvanized versus color coated), wire gauge, mesh size, and the number and type of gates. High security features such as barbed wire, razor ribbon, or privacy slats add to material and labor costs but may be essential for certain facilities.
Site conditions play a major role. Rocky ground, steep slopes, limited access for equipment, or the need to cut and patch asphalt or concrete will increase installation time and cost. Urban or tight Belleville sites, such as around existing buildings or near public sidewalks, often require more hand work and careful staging.
To help commercial clients stay within budget, we often present tiered options. For example, you might secure your entire perimeter with standard galvanized chain link at a certain height, then upgrade only critical areas near loading docks or equipment storage with heavier fabric, taller fence, or barbed wire. We can also phase projects over time so you can secure priority sections first and expand later.
